The Appeal of a 2-Person Pressure Cooker

Pressure cookers have earned their place in many kitchens for their ability to drastically reduce cooking time while enhancing flavors. A 2-person pressure cooker stands out as a perfect choice for smaller households or couples. It provides the efficiency of a larger pressure cooker, but in a compact and manageable form. So why would a small pressure cooker be an ideal investment for just two people?

For starters, the size. A 2-person pressure cooker is typically designed with a capacity ranging from 1.5 to 3 liters. This size is perfect for making quick, hearty meals without over-preparing food. Whether you’re preparing stews, rice, or soups, it offers enough room to make meals for two without wasting ingredients. Additionally, because it is smaller, it heats up faster, which can help save energy. If you’ve ever had a large cooker that takes forever to heat, you’ll appreciate this efficiency.

Examples Imagine preparing a creamy chicken curry or a lentil stew in less than 30 minutes. A 2-person pressure cooker makes it possible to cook these dishes in a fraction of the time compared to traditional methods.

Another advantage is convenience. A compact pressure cooker doesn’t take up much storage space, making it a great option for smaller kitchens. Moreover, many 2-person models are built with non-stick surfaces, making them easy to clean after use.

The Versatility of a 20-Person Pressure Cooker

While a 2-person pressure cooker suits smaller families, larger gatherings might call for something more substantial. A 20-person pressure cooker could be your secret weapon when preparing meals for a crowd. These larger models typically have a capacity ranging from 6 to 10 liters, allowing you to cook large batches of food quickly.

Why would you opt for such a large pressure cooker? If you regularly entertain guests or need to prepare meals for extended family, a large pressure cooker can be a time-saver. Not only does it reduce cooking time, but it also ensures that you’re able to feed many people with minimal effort.

Case Study A family reunion with 20 attendees? A 20-person pressure cooker can handle everything from hearty chili to beef stew. Imagine making enough food in one go, saving you from having to cook in batches or rely on multiple pots.

Another great feature of large pressure cookers is that they often come with multiple pressure settings, allowing you to cook a variety of dishes to perfection, whether it’s a slow-simmered stew or a quick-braised chicken dish. It also reduces the need for constant supervision during cooking, which is a real time-saver when preparing for a large number of people.

Price for 2 People: What You Should Expect

When shopping for a 2-person pressure cooker, it’s important to understand the price range and what to expect for your investment. Generally speaking, the cost of a 2-person pressure cooker can vary based on the brand, material, and features. You can find a basic model for as low as $30, while higher-end versions may cost up to $100 or more.

So, what affects the price of a pressure cooker for two people? Material quality is a major factor. Stainless steel models tend to cost more than aluminum ones but are known for their durability and resistance to corrosion. Features also play a role: some models come with advanced pressure settings, digital controls, or even smart cooking functions, which can drive the price up.

Example A basic stainless steel pressure cooker with minimal features may cost around $50. Meanwhile, a high-tech, multi-functional pressure cooker with preset cooking programs and a larger pressure gauge can cost anywhere from $90 to $120.

If you’re on a budget, it’s still possible to find quality pressure cookers that provide great value. Many mid-range models offer excellent performance without breaking the bank.
